The author of this article has confused the entire purpose of the hbd_print_rate and essentially hijacked it, claiming it had a different purpose that somehow got missed for the DHF. If you're interested in the details of what the hbd_print_rate actually does, you can read more about it in @andablackwidow post below.
But to the basic point without the details: the hbd_print_rate doesn't change the amount of rewards that are given for posts. It only changes the currency used. Somehow that's now being conflated as "DHF payments should be cut whenever post payments are paid in Hive instead of HBD". The argument makes no sense, IMO.
So if we wanted to change the behavior of the DHF to match the way it works for posts, the change would be to pay in terms of Hive instead of HBD. I think it has been suggested before. But IMO, this would not have any major impact one way or the other, practically speaking.
